#
# Every read first consults this filter to avoid disk lookups for absent
# keys. Security note: the filter is probabilistic, so a false positive
# only causes a harmless extra lookup; it never leaks key contents, and
# hash seeds are fixed at build time rather than derived from user input,
# preventing attacker-controlled collision crafting. Resizing triggers a
# full rebuild under the store's write lock, so sizing matters. The
# constants below were validated against the Larchbrook audit checklist.

tuning constants:
QUOTAS = {
    "druwyn": 5,
    "holix": 5,
    "zorath": 5,
    "holwyn": 10,
}

Heads up on the cutoff logic in Crumbwheel's order service: we now reject same-day cake orders after the store-local cutoff, but the check happens client-side first and server-side second, so please eyeball the server path for clock-skew games. Someone could spoof their timezone header to sneak an order past closing at the Maplegate branch. I clamped skew to a small window and added a grace period for in-flight carts. The tuning constants we settled on are below:

constants for bawif-kawif:
QUOTAS = {
    "ulaael": 5,
    "holael": 10,
}

Welcome to on-call for the Glimmerpane design system! Our snapshot tests live in the `snapcheck` suite and run on every merge to main. If a UI component changes visually, the diff bot flags it — usually it's an intentional tweak, so just approve the new baseline. If it's 2am and snapshots are failing across the board, it's almost always a font-loading race, not your problem. To unlock the baseline store and re-approve snapshots in bulk, use the recovery passphrase below.

recovery phrase for tahag-taguf: wenix-caswyn

Subject: DR drill tomorrow — heads up on the autocomplete thing

Hey! Quick note before tomorrow's disaster-recovery drill at Snowgate. You'll see the Pintail autocomplete index crawl — that's intentional; we throttle it to simulate degraded search while we fail over to the warm replica. Don't panic and don't restart anything. Your only job: restore the drill vault snapshot when I ping you. To unseal it, type in the recovery passphrase right below this line.

vault phrase of fahog-yajog = frawyn-jordor-casael-gormir-olieth-julmir